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merge dev on master #1110

Closed
wants to merge 328 commits into from
Closed

Merge dev on master #1110

wants to merge 328 commits into from

Conversation

jose-luis-rs
Copy link
Contributor


Checklist:

jose-luis-rs and others added 30 commits December 20, 2022 13:36
Update CMakeLists.txt

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again

Update CMakeLists.txt again
Added califa/geobase folder

Use of dynamic_cast
Added automatic generation for CALIFA root geometry

Minor changes for R3BAlpide.cxx
Changed the names for CALIFA root geometries
Update input/p2p/qfs.C

Added Licence headers

Minor change in main.yml

Minor change in main.yml

Minor change in main.yml

Minor change in main.yml

Minor change in main.yml

More modifications for CI tests
Changed containers by .githubfiles

Added && build-r3broot to main.yml

Added && build-r3broot to main.yml

Added && build-r3broot to main.yml

Removed && build-r3broot from main.yml

Clang-format applied over all files
Minor change in .github/workflows/main.yml
Commented glad-tpc CI test again
Added missing includes, FairRootManager and TCA
Updated Neuland lambda expression

CI changes:
* CMake errors will now be sent to console
* clang-format will upload a ready-to-apply diff
  to sprunge.us on failure.

Rebased.

Moved all format related scripts to util.
Removed stack->SetDebug in gconfig/g4Config.C
Clang-format

Solved problems with field/R3BFieldPar.cxx

Update again license years
Use of R3BStack instead of FairStack in gconfig/g3Config.C

Added again FATAL_ERROR to detect failed tests

Test error deliberate

Inverting error
testCalifaSimulation.C: Update name for the Califa root geometry

Update r3bgen/test/testR3BPhaseSpaceGeneratorIntegration.C
jose-luis-rs and others added 29 commits April 6, 2024 22:25
Update version v3 to v4

Removed unused includes
Clean-up and minor improvements in los classes.

Include timing of S2 hit after subtraction of the reference time in FrsSciPosCalData.

Bug fix in R3BFrsSciTcal2Cal when obtaining good pairs of hits of left and right PMTs.

Update IncomingData to reconstruct S2(FrsSci) to LosCal for s091 experiment. Los CFD out was used for the Tref signal for S2, so LosCal is used for reconstructing ToF specific to the experiment.
When multiple hits in Los are seen, only selecting good hit wrt the trigger timing is choosen.
CMake targets imported from ROOT using config mode is suggested both
from ROOT and FairRoot. Libraries generated with different detectors are
also represented by proper CMake targets for easier dependency
management.
Fix the value of the total energy
Conan package manager is now added to R3BRoot. By default, it's disable.
Building the project with conan package manager can be achieved with
cmake preset and conan cmake wrapper as a git submodule.
Adding new class R3BDataMonitor for easy histogram operations in
FairTask. New class ValueError can be used to represent values with
errors. R3BFileSource2 now can handle root files just with root tree
inside. Documentation of these new classes and changes have been added
to the README.md in the r3bbase folder.
Add a new feature of FileSource2 that can specify each individual input
file with or without tree option.
Update list of Authors

Added zenodo DOI

Minor

Added zenodo DOI

gROOT->Reset() for create_califa_geo.C

Changed CMakeLists.txt

Changed CMakeLists.txt

Another tests

Again nov22p1

Recover CMakeLists.txt for califa/geobase

Update github workflow
Minor change

Added new zenodo ID

Update COPYRIGHT

Added more authors

Added more coauthors
Update

Connecting again the califa geometry test
Added bestpractices badge

Update readme

Update readme

Update readme

Update readme

Update Copyright

Added Deniz to the list of contributors

Added fair-software.yml

Update zenodo file

Minor

Minor

Update github workflows

Update github workflows

Update scripts for generating json files

Added more contributors

Update codemeta.json

Update codemeta.json

Update codemeta.json

Minor change readme

Minor change

Clang-format

Update authors

Minor change for zenodo

Update cleanup_cache.yml

Deleted old folders xball, mfi and lumon

Added a display for cmake status

Added a display for SUPPORTED_CXX_STANDARDS

Added a display for CMAKE_CXX_STANDARD

Removed old detector classes for lumon, mfi and xball

Removed xball from compilehelper/CMakeLists.txt

Added color to supported C++ standards

Minor change in the general CMakeLists-txt
Added minor versions for fairsoft and fairroot
Further changes:
- Remove conda usage in CI
- Add GTest from CMakeFetchContent
Changed imagen for debian10

Changed imagen for debian10 again

Changed imagen for debian10 again

Changed imagen for debian10 again

Changed imagen for debian10 again

Again

Again

Update of libc6

Update
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.